Section 437.413 - Commission's Intervention in Civil Action By Complainant

After receipt of a timely application, a court may permit the commission to intervene in a civil action filed under Section 437.412 if:

(1) the commission certifies that the case is of general public importance; and
(2) before commencement of the action, the commission issued a determination of reasonable cause to believe that Section 437.204 was violated.
